Analysis
What drives eviction risk in Malmstrom Air Force Base
This is renter territory: 97% of occupied units are tenant-occupied. Running cool, economic stress reads 1/10. 27% of renter households cross the 30%-of-income line, well below the Cascade County average of 37.1%.
Well under the midpoint, state political climate reads 1.7/10. On the national scale it lands near the 20th percentile of the 84,120 tracts scored. CDC social-vulnerability scoring puts the tract at 1.7/10.
Of its three components the household composition measure is the least pressured. Poverty sits at 3%, low enough that arrears here usually signal a specific shock rather than a structural income gap. It tracks the Cascade County average of 3.5 closely.
Average gross rent is $1,237, close to the Malmstrom AFB average. Annual rent works out to 20% of average household income of $75,491.
These are ACS 5-year estimates; the score moves when the ACS, court-record, or statute inputs behind it move.
